Today's feature is on this vintage 1 oz "Williams Gold Refining Co. of Canada" silver bar produced in the early 80s.
Williams has been refining metals in Ontario, Canada since 1917 but gave up producing bullion items for sale to the public in 1988. Now they refine and make dental alloys for the dental industry and are one of the premier companies for that service in North America. These bars are fairly rare and super unique. Notice it's got a incuse design where the logo and letters are punched down into the bar
